Caffè Nero opens at BBC Broadcasting House, London

Caffè Nero Group Ltd has opened a branch at BBC Broadcasting House, Portland Place, in Central London. The Italian-style coffee shop chain occupies a prominent 1,200 sq ft retail unit on the ground floor.

Lambert Smith Hampton (LSH) acted on the BBC’s behalf to agree a 10-year lease. Broadcasting House has undergone a £1bn redevelopment, with over 6,000 staff migrating to the new building. Caffè Nero is open to the public and BBC staff.

Mark Painter, Director of Retail Agency at LSH, said: “The BBC was keen to ensure a well-matched tenant was secured, that was both a high quality and flexible operator. Broadcasting House is an iconic building and the focal point of the BBC in Central London.

“We worked in partnership with the BBC to ensure a perfect match was found. Caffè Nero is the first independent café retailer to locate in the building.”
